黑狐家游戏

ce ph是什么样的分布式存储,深入剖析Ceph分布式存储系统,构建高效、可靠的数据中心基石

欧气 0 0

本文目录导读:

  1. Ceph分布式存储系统概述
  2. Ceph分布式存储系统架构
  3. Ceph分布式存储系统搭建步骤
  4. Ceph分布式存储系统优化

Ceph分布式存储系统概述

Ceph是一款开源的分布式存储系统,旨在提供高可用、高性能、高扩展性的存储解决方案,自2004年由Sage Weil创立以来,Ceph已发展成为一个成熟、稳定的分布式存储系统,广泛应用于云计算、大数据、人工智能等领域。

Ceph分布式存储系统具有以下特点:

ce ph是什么样的分布式存储,深入剖析Ceph分布式存储系统,构建高效、可靠的数据中心基石

图片来源于网络,如有侵权联系删除

1、高可用性:Ceph通过副本机制,确保数据在多个节点上存储,即使部分节点故障,也不会影响数据的访问。

2、高性能:Ceph采用多路径IO、异步复制等技术,提供高速的读写性能。

3、高扩展性:Ceph支持在线水平扩展,可根据业务需求动态调整存储容量。

4、良好的兼容性:Ceph支持多种存储接口,如块设备、文件系统和对象存储,方便与其他系统对接。

5、开源:Ceph是开源软件,用户可以免费使用,降低成本。

Ceph分布式存储系统架构

Ceph分布式存储系统采用一种名为RADOS(Reliable Autonomic Distributed Object Store)的对象存储架构,该架构主要由以下组件组成:

1、OSD(Object Storage Device):负责存储数据,每个OSD可以是一个硬盘、SSD或RAID组。

2、Mon(Monitor):监控集群状态,维护元数据,确保集群的稳定性。

3、MDS(Metadata Server):负责管理文件系统的元数据,提高文件系统的性能。

4、RGW(Rados Gateway):提供对象存储接口,如S3、Swift等。

5、CephFS:Ceph文件系统,提供POSIX兼容的文件系统接口。

6、RBD(Rados Block Device):提供块设备接口,可挂载到虚拟机或物理机。

ce ph是什么样的分布式存储,深入剖析Ceph分布式存储系统,构建高效、可靠的数据中心基石

图片来源于网络,如有侵权联系删除

7、Ceph Manager:提供集群监控、告警、性能分析等功能。

Ceph分布式存储系统搭建步骤

1、环境准备

确保所有节点满足以下条件:

(1)操作系统:支持Ceph的Linux发行版,如CentOS、Ubuntu等。

(2)硬件:至少2GB内存,至少1TB硬盘空间。

(3)网络:节点间网络延迟低于10ms,带宽不低于1Gbps。

2、安装Ceph

在所有节点上安装Ceph软件,以下以CentOS为例:

(1)添加Ceph源:

sudo rpm --import https://download.ceph.com/keys/release.asc
sudo vi /etc/yum.repos.d/ceph.repo

(2)配置Ceph源:

[ceph]
name=Ceph packages for $basearch
baseurl=https://download.ceph.com/rpm-luminous/$basearch/
enabled=1
gpgcheck=1
gpgkey=https://download.ceph.com/keys/release.asc

(3)安装Ceph软件:

sudo yum install ceph ceph-deploy

3、创建集群

ce ph是什么样的分布式存储,深入剖析Ceph分布式存储系统,构建高效、可靠的数据中心基石

图片来源于网络,如有侵权联系删除

使用ceph-deploy工具创建集群:

ceph-deploy new <cluster_name> <node1> <node2> ...

4、添加Mon节点

ceph-deploy mon create <node1>

5、添加OSD节点

ceph-deploy osd create <node1> <device1>

6、添加MDS节点(可选)

ceph-deploy mds create <node1>

7、添加RGW节点(可选)

ceph-deploy rgw create <node1> <node2>

8、验证集群状态

ceph -s

Ceph分布式存储系统优化

1、调整副本因子:根据业务需求调整副本因子,降低存储成本或提高数据可靠性。

2、调整IO策略:根据存储设备的性能特点,调整IO策略,提高系统性能。

3、使用SSD缓存:将热点数据存储在SSD上,提高读写性能。

4、定期监控:使用Ceph Manager或其他监控工具,定期监控集群状态,及时发现并解决问题。

Ceph分布式存储系统凭借其高可用、高性能、高扩展性等特点,已成为数据中心构建的重要基石,通过本文的介绍,相信大家对Ceph分布式存储系统有了更深入的了解,在实际应用中,根据业务需求,合理配置和优化Ceph存储系统,将为数据中心带来更高的价值。

标签: #ceph分布式存储系统搭建

黑狐家游戏
  • 评论列表

留言评论